Babine Camp is looking for Housekeeping Attendants for it’s logging camp across Babine Lake. Duties include: Maintaining bunkhouse accommodations Making and... changing beds Vacuuming, sweeping and washing floors Cleaning washrooms, shower / tub rooms and laundry rooms Collecting and disposing of garbage and debris Report to Head Camp Attendant any damage done in bunkhouses Camp is 5 days on 2 off or 4 days on 3 off. New covid-19 cases in BC: 234 Hospitalized: 86 ICU: 24 1 new death that will be discussed below. New Covid-19 Northern Health Cases: 7... The death was a person Dr. Henry described to help people understand how even small gatherings can lead to a death of a loved one. She had attended a small birthday party with less than 10 people. One person in the group had covid-19 and every person there contracted it, including this woman in her 80s who was admitted to hospital and then died.

Tips to stop a car when one of the tires explodes when speed exceeds 100 km/h 1. First tip: When a tyre explodes try to stay as calm as possible and hold the st...eering wheel firmly with both hands. 2. Second tip: It's the most important keep your foot off the brakes and don't push it at all. Don’t even look at the brake pedal, don’t even think about it. 3. Third tip: Stay on your path and try not to change it or get out of anyone’s way, stay on a path as straight as possible. 4. Fourth tip: If your car has a manual transmission, gradually change to a lower BUT ONLY do so if you feel that the car is completely under control. If your car has an automatic transmission, stay in the Drive (D) gear DO NOT change. 5. Fifth tip: Don't use brakes, the drag from the exploded tire will slow you down. 6.
